Team,

As our incoming director, Maren Olsvik, reviews pipeline commitments, please note the updated discount framework for deals above the enterprise threshold. Standard approval caps at 15%; anything beyond requires dual sign-off from Finance and the regional VP. We have seen margin erosion on Veltrix Suite renewals, so consistency matters here. Exceptions should be rare, documented, and tied to multi-year terms. The strategic rationale behind these limits is summarized in the confidential note below.

internal memo for hahaf-kahof: Only 39 of the 428 pilot accounts renewed Sorion, so a churn review is set for April 12. Praokix Freight is in early talks to buy Queniusox Group for about $145.8 million.

## Replica lag alarm — Brambleworks DB tier

Quick context for review: the Fernhollow read replicas occasionally fall behind during bulk imports, and stale reads there could let a revoked session linger longer than we'd like. So we're adding a lag alarm that flips the replica out of rotation and pages on-call. Nothing exotic security-wise — no new credentials, just a metrics poller. Thresholds and polling cadence are as follows.

limits module of fajog-tawig:
RATE_LIMITS = {
    "druwyn": 2,
    "quenael": 10,
    "wenix": 2,
    "druael": 2,
}

## Service Accounts

The Poolmarsh connection pooler runs under the svc-pooler account, which owns all database connections for the Lanternfish cluster. New team members should never connect as personal users in staging. The pooler authenticates to the internal credentials broker using the key shown below.

app token of bawep-hafog = kto7_vwrmnlx

Subject: SpoolLite key rotation — heads up for the sync

Team,

Before Thursday's eng sync: the SpoolLite printer-spooler microservice had its credentials rotated after the Harstead cluster migration. Old keys are revoked as of tonight. Update your staging configs and the print-queue smoke tests accordingly. Anyone running local integration tests should pull the new value now. The rotated key follows below.

app token of tadug-yahag = vxb3-949